Subject: [PATCH 2/3] dt-bindings: iio: light: add stk33xx
Date: Wed, 3 Jul 2019 20:05:58 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190703180604.9840-2-luca@z3ntu.xyz>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20190703180604.9840-1-luca@z3ntu.xyz>
Add binding documentation for the stk33xx family of ambient light
sensors.
Signed-off-by: Luca Weiss <luca@z3ntu.xyz>
---
.../bindings/iio/light/stk33xx.yaml | 49 +++++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 49 insertions(+)
create mode 100644 Documentation/devicetree/bindings/iio/light/stk33xx.yaml
di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/iio/light/stk33xx.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/iio/light/stk33xx.yaml
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..aae8a6d627c9
--- /dev/null
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/iio/light/stk33xx.yaml
@@ -0,0 +1,49 @@
+#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0 OR BSD-2-Clause)
+%YAML 1.2
+---
+$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/iio/light/stk33xx.yaml#
+$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#
+
+title: |
+ Sensortek STK33xx I2C Ambient Light and Proximity sensor
+
+maintainers:
+ - Jonathan Cameron <jic23@kernel.org>
+
+description: |
+ Ambient light and proximity sensor over an i2c interface.
+
+properties:
+ compatible:
+ enum:
+ - sensortek,stk3310
+ - sensortek,stk3311
+ - sensortek,stk3335
+
+ reg:
+ maxItems: 1
+
+ interrupts:
+ maxItems: 1
+
+required:
+ - compatible
+ - reg
+
+examples:
+ - |
+ #include <dt-bindings/interrupt-controller/irq.h>
+
+ i2c {
+
+ #address-cells = <1>;
+ #size-cells = <0>;
+
+ stk3310@48 {
+ compatible = "sensortek,stk3310";
+ reg = <0x48>;
+ interrupt-parent = <&gpio1>;
+ interrupts = <5 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_LOW>;
+ };
+ };
+...
